توضیحات
پروژه بانک اطلاعاتی انبارداری با SQL Server یک نمونهی آموزشی و کاربردی برای یادگیری مفاهیم طراحی پایگاه داده و مدیریت موجودی کالا است.این پروژه بهویژه برای دانشجویان رشته کامپیوتر، علاقهمندان به SQL، برنامهنویسان بکاند و مدیران انبار طراحی شده است تا با ساختارهای دادهای، روابط جداول، کوئرینویسی پیشرفته و مفاهیم اصلی سیستمهای انبارداری آشنا شوند.
امکانات و ویژگیهای پروژه بانک اطلاعاتی انبارداری با SQL
این پروژه پایگاه داده با SQL Server شامل تمام اجزای موردنیاز برای پیادهسازی یک سیستم انبارداری ساده ولی کامل است:
-
🧱 اسکریپت ساخت دیتابیس در SQL Server
-
طراحی جداول اصلی شامل کالا، انبار، تأمینکننده، دستهبندی و تراکنشها
-
🗓️ درج دادههای تستی فارسی با پشتیبانی از تاریخ شمسی
-
نمودار ERD جهت نمایش روابط بین جداول
-
۱۰ کوئری کاربردی و مدیریتی برای گزارشگیری، بررسی موجودی کالا، آمار ورود و خروج و تحلیل دادهها
ساختار جداول پایگاه داده پروژه بانک اطلاعاتی انبارداری با SQL
در این پروژه، جداول اصلی با رعایت اصول نرمالسازی طراحی شدهاند:
| نام جدول | توضیحات |
|---|---|
| Categories | شامل دستهبندی کالاها (مانند لوازم مصرفی، پوشاک، قطعات صنعتی و …) |
| Products | مشخصات کالا شامل نام، قیمت، واحد اندازهگیری و کد کالا |
| Warehouses | اطلاعات انبارهای مختلف شامل نام انبار، موقعیت مکانی و ظرفیت |
| Suppliers | اطلاعات تأمینکنندگان و فروشندگان کالا |
| StockTransactions | ثبت تمامی تراکنشهای ورود و خروج کالا بههمراه تاریخ شمسی، تعداد، نوع عملیات و مرجع تأمینکننده |
کاربردها و مزایای پروژه
پروژه پایگاه داده انبارداری علاوه بر جنبه آموزشی، میتواند پایهای برای توسعه نرمافزارهای بزرگتر نیز باشد. برخی از کاربردهای آن عبارتند از:
-
تمرین مفاهیم JOIN، GROUP BY، Aggregation و Subquery
-
طراحی گزارشهای مدیریتی انبار (موجودی، گردش کالا، عملکرد تأمینکنندگان)
-
اتصال به نرمافزارهای مدیریتی یا سیستمهای ERP
-
استفاده بهعنوان پروژه دانشجویی SQL Server برای یادگیری طراحی دیتابیس
نمودار ERD پروژه
در نمودار ERD این پروژه بانک اطلاعاتی انبارداری با SQL، ارتباط بین جداول بهصورت منطقی و رابطهای نمایش داده شده است:
-
هر کالا به یک دستهبندی (Category) وابسته است
-
هر تراکنش شامل اطلاعات مربوط به کالا، انبار و تأمینکننده میباشد
-
تراکنشها دارای تاریخ شمسی، تعداد و نوع عملیات (ورود یا خروج) هستند
کوئریهای SQL موجود در پروژه
در این پروژه بیش از ۱۰ کوئری مفید و متنوع برای اهداف تحلیلی و مدیریتی طراحی شدهاند. برخی از مهمترین آنها عبارتند از:
-
نمایش موجودی فعلی هر کالا
-
فهرست تراکنشهای ورود و خروج کالا
-
شناسایی کالاهای بدون تراکنش
-
گزارش آمار کلی موجودی انبارها
-
نمایش کالاها بر اساس دستهبندی
-
تشخیص پرفروشترین یا پرتراکنشترین کالاها


دیدگاهها
هیچ دیدگاهی برای این محصول نوشته نشده است.